The 2026 NFL Draft is shaping up to be unpredictable, with the Raiders selecting quarterback Fernando Mendoza at number one. The Cleveland Browns, needing a wide receiver, left tackle, or quarterback, might surprise everyone by drafting Alabama offensive tackle Kadyn Proctor at number six. Proctor, a non-consensus top-ten pick, has rare size and quick feet, making him a mismatch nightmare. His stock soared after Alabamas pro day, potentially redefining how teams value massive linemen in the draft.
